About this cabin rental

Summary:

Seeking adventure? A quiet reprieve? We've got it all in Copperhill! Cabin #4 can sleep up to 8 guests comfortably, making it ideal for a family getaway.

The charming interior boasts a rustic vibe thanks to the wooden decor, and features a couple of sofas in the living room for guests to kick back and enjoy some down time together in front of the TV, which is set up with Roku streaming tv's and a DVD player. Use The Lodge (pool and ping pong tables, juke box system, fire rings & more)!



The Space:

Wander the grounds or fish (catch & release) at the 1/2 acre stocked pond. The property is great for grabing a blanket and having a piknic or stargazing in the large open area.



Guest Access:

Access everything within the cabin and on the porch. The stocked pond, large firepit and small stream are all accessable to guests. Fishing poles are also available at no additional charge.



The Neighborhood:

We have 8.5 acres with four cabins, owner's residence, game room, fire pits, picnic tables, glamping tents and outdoor wedding venue, 1/4 acre stocked fishing pond, old fashioned horseshoe pit, Great areas to play outside. Mountain/Rustic/Country setting.



Getting Around:

You'll need a vehicle to get around. Other than the amenities on the property, walking is not really an option. The small twin cities of Copperhill, TN & McCaysville, GA are approximately 3 miles (a 4 minute drive). Blue Ridge, GA is a 12 mile drive.

We had a wonderful time in Cabin 4. It says it sleeps 8, which it does, but it may be a little cramped if you actually had 8 people in the cabin all at the same time. We are a family with 2 teens and it was perfect for us. The property is beautiful, the location is close to several things to do, and if you just want to sit around and hang out at the cabin there is plenty to do. The kids went fishing the first day we were there and we spent our evenings sitting by the fire, visiting with other campers, playing pool, ping pong and listening to the radio. Our two teens were not bored at all and it was nice to have them actually interacting and hanging out with us which doesn’t happen very often with busy schedules and friends. The cabin has cups, plates, silverware and bowls. They have a few pots and pans and a very tiny little cookie sheet that I could fit 4 biscuits on. If you are wanting to bake anything you may bring a cookie sheet of your own but it is a small stove. 1/2 the size of a normal stove but it gets the job done. There are no storage containers so if you cook too much either bring baggies or a couple plastic bowls with you and some Saran Wrap or foil. They do have sugar, coffee and several spices. There’s a microwave, toaster, and coffee maker. I had thought I read somewhere about a blow dryer but you will need to bring one of you use one. The furnace kept us plenty warm and they have an ac window unit for summer. Definitely recommend this place!
